## Onboarding: Catalog cache invalidation

The Lumenshelf catalog caches product pages at the edge. Writes publish an invalidation event; the purge worker consumes it and clears affected keys within seconds. Stale entries usually mean the worker lost its bus connection. To run the worker locally, your env file needs the purge-bus credential on the following line.

sealed setting: ARCHIVE_KEY3=8d0

### FAQ: Why does Perchline intermittently fail DNS lookups?

The internal resolver on the Dunmoor segment occasionally returns SERVFAIL under load; Perchline's short client timeout makes this look like an outage. Mitigation: raise the timeout, enable retry-once, and pin the secondary resolver. If the admin cache must be flushed, open the resolver console and enter the recovery passphrase below.

recovery phrase for fajep-yaweg: gilath-sorox-wenius-rusdor-keliel-zorius

## Further reading

Plugin handlers on the Skiffrun platform run as serverless functions and are subject to cold starts. Keep init code minimal, lazy-load heavy dependencies, and avoid network calls at import time. Typical cold-start overhead is 200–800ms depending on bundle size. Benchmarks, warm-pool behavior, and optimization guidelines are covered in the internal doc below.

runbook for taduf-kawef: https://confluence.qorvelsys.internal/projects/display/display/pages